How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Entertainment District?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Entertainment District Studio Apartments | $1,008 | $579 | $3,198 |
| Entertainment District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,367 | $650 | $7,826 |
| Entertainment District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,883 | $1,099 | $9,123 |
| Entertainment District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,460 | $1,399 | $1,988 |
| Entertainment District 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,819 | $4,819 | $4,819 |
